内容简介
本书是美国Robert L. Mott教授所著Machine Elements in Mechanical Design(Fourth Edition,2004)的缩编版。缩编者在保持原书特色和风格的前提下,根据我国机械设计课程的教学要求,删去了原书中与我国其他先修课程重复的部分内容,将原书23章缩编为16章,并将计量单位转换为公制。缩编后的内容包括:机械设计概论,带传动与链传动,齿轮传动与蜗杆传动,轴,轴联接件(键、联轴器、密封),滚动轴承,滑动轴承,紧固件,弹簧,机座,离合器与制动器,设计大作业等。
本书可作为高等学校工科机械类专业机械设计课程的双语教学教材,也可供从事机械专业的教师、研究生或工程技术人员参考。
